全部产品
Search
文档中心

大数据开发治理平台 DataWorks:ListWorkflowDefinitions - 获取数据开发工作流列表

更新时间:Dec 05, 2024

分页获取数据开发工作流列表,也可以根据筛选条件对工作流进行筛选。

调试

您可以在OpenAPI Explorer中直接运行该接口,免去您计算签名的困扰。运行成功后,OpenAPI Explorer可以自动生成SDK代码示例。

授权信息

当前API暂无授权信息透出。

请求参数

名称类型必填描述示例值
ProjectIdstring

DataWorks 工作空间的 ID。您可以登录 DataWorks 控制台,进入工作空间配置页面获取工作空间 ID。

该参数用来确定本次 API 调用操作使用的 DataWorks 工作空间。

10000
Typestring

筛选条件:工作流的类型

可选值

  • CycleWorkflow
  • ManualWorkflow
CycleWorkflow
Ownerstring

负责人的 ID,即工作空间管理员的账号 UID。您可登录阿里云控制台后,在账号管理的安全管理中查看账号 UID。

110755000425XXXX
PageNumberinteger

请求的数据页数,用于翻页。

1
PageSizeinteger

每页显示的条数,默认为 10 条,最大为 100 条。

10

返回参数

名称类型描述示例值
object

Schema of Response

RequestIdstring

请求 ID。用于定位日志,排查问题。

8C3ED0C5-ABAB-55E1-854B-DAC02B11XXXX
PagingInfoobject

分页信息

TotalCountinteger

满足条件的数据总条数。

227
PageSizeinteger

每页显示的条数

10
PageNumberinteger

请求的数据页数,用于翻页。

1
WorkflowDefinitionsarray<object>

查询到的工作流列表

workflowDefinitionobject
ProjectIdstring

工作流所在 DataWorks 空间的 ID。

4710
Ownerstring

责任人

110755000425XXXX
CreateTimelong

创建工作流时间戳

1698057323000
ModifyTimelong

最近修改工作流的时间戳

1698057323000
Descriptionstring

描述

工作流描述
Typestring

工作流类型

可选值

  • CycleWorkflow
  • ManualWorkflow
CycleWorkflow
Scriptobject

脚本信息

Pathstring

脚本路径

XX/OpenAPI测试/工作流测试/OpenAPI测试工作流Demo
Runtimeobject

运行时

Commandstring

命令

WORKFLOW
Idstring

脚本 id

698002781368644XXXX
Idstring

唯一 ID

463497880880954XXXX
Namestring

工作流名称

OpenAPI测试工作流Demo

示例

正常返回示例

JSON格式

{
  "RequestId": "8C3ED0C5-ABAB-55E1-854B-DAC02B11XXXX",
  "PagingInfo": {
    "TotalCount": 227,
    "PageSize": 10,
    "PageNumber": 1,
    "WorkflowDefinitions": [
      {
        "ProjectId": "4710",
        "Owner": "110755000425XXXX",
        "CreateTime": 1698057323000,
        "ModifyTime": 1698057323000,
        "Description": "工作流描述",
        "Type": "CycleWorkflow",
        "Script": {
          "Path": "XX/OpenAPI测试/工作流测试/OpenAPI测试工作流Demo",
          "Runtime": {
            "Command": "WORKFLOW"
          },
          "Id": "698002781368644XXXX"
        },
        "Id": "463497880880954XXXX",
        "Name": "OpenAPI测试工作流Demo"
      }
    ]
  }
}

错误码

访问错误中心查看更多错误码。